What to Look For in a Great Hertel Avenue Coffee Shop
When I’m on the hunt for a fantastic coffee experience on Hertel Avenue, I have a few criteria that usually guide my decision. These are things that, in my opinion, elevate a coffee shop from merely good to truly exceptional.
- Bean Quality and Sourcing: Are the beans ethically sourced? Do they offer single-origin options? Understanding where the coffee comes from adds a layer of appreciation.
- Barista Expertise: A skilled barista can make all the difference. I look for those who are knowledgeable about their craft, can explain the different brewing methods, and pull a perfect espresso shot.
- Menu Variety: Beyond the standard espresso drinks, do they offer unique seasonal specials or alternative milk options? A well-rounded menu is a plus.
- Atmosphere and Ambiance: Is it a place where you feel comfortable staying for a while? Good lighting, comfortable seating, and a pleasant noise level are crucial.
- Food Offerings: While coffee is the star, delicious pastries, sandwiches, or breakfast items can make a coffee shop a complete destination.
- Community Vibe: Does the shop feel like a part of the neighborhood? Friendly staff and a welcoming atmosphere contribute significantly.

What are the operating hours for most coffee shops on Hertel Avenue?
Operating hours can vary significantly from one coffee shop to another, but generally, you’ll find that most establishments on Hertel Avenue are open from early morning to late afternoon or early evening. Typically, you can expect coffee shops to open between 7:00 AM and 9:00 AM, making them accessible for your morning commute or a leisurely start to the day. Closing times often range from 4:00 PM to 7:00 PM. Weekend hours might be slightly different, with some places opening a bit later on Saturdays and Sundays, and potentially closing a little earlier as well. However, a few might extend their hours into the evening, especially if they also serve as wine bars or have a more social evening atmosphere. For the most accurate and up-to-date information, I always recommend checking the specific coffee shop’s website or their social media pages before you visit, as hours can occasionally change due to holidays or special events.

What makes Hertel Avenue a great location for coffee shops?
Hertel Avenue’s appeal as a prime location for coffee shops stems from a confluence of factors that create a dynamic and supportive environment for these businesses. Firstly, its high pedestrian traffic is a significant advantage. The street is a popular destination for residents and visitors alike, drawn by its eclectic mix of boutiques, restaurants, and cultural venues. This constant flow of people naturally translates into a steady stream of potential customers for coffee shops. Secondly, the neighborhood itself, particularly North Park, boasts a diverse and engaged community that values local businesses and artisanal products. There’s a palpable appreciation for quality coffee and a desire to support independent establishments.
Furthermore, Hertel Avenue has undergone a revitalization in recent years, attracting new entrepreneurs and fostering a sense of innovation. This has created a fertile ground for businesses, including coffee shops, to not only survive but thrive. The street’s walkability and relatively accessible parking also contribute to its appeal, making it easy for people to visit multiple establishments throughout the day. The unique blend of residential charm and commercial vibrancy creates an ideal ecosystem for coffee shops to flourish, serving as both essential daily stops and destinations for exploration. It’s this combination of foot traffic, community support, and a revitalized urban landscape that makes Hertel Avenue such a sweet spot for caffeine lovers.
